Guidelines for IVF Application in the United States: Process, Time, and Preparation Points
Test tube encyclopedia website 2026-02-05 13:04:41 In vitro fertilization in the United States Read: 7449 timesThe complete journey of in vitro fertilization in the United States, from visa appointment to embryo transfer, usually takes 90-180 days. If combined with hysteroscopy, immune regulation, or genetic testing, the cycle may be extended to 8-10 months. Breaking down the timeline into five major segments: "domestic preparation - initiation of travel to the United States - clinical operations - pregnancy confirmation - follow-up prenatal check ups" can simultaneously advance on the three lines of scheduling, funding, and physical health, minimizing the number of round trips and waiting gaps. 3、 Cost Structure: Understanding the 2024 Market with One Table
| project | Unit price (USD) | notes |
|---|---|---|
| Initial diagnosis+first-year embryo freezing | 3,500 | Most clinics offer bundled prices, including 1 year of storage |
| Promotion of ovulation+egg retrieval+ICSI+culture | 14,000-16,000 | The cost of medication is separately calculated, approximately 3000-6000 |
| Embryo chromosome screening (per individual) | 350-450 | Usually inspect 5-8 pieces, with a total price of around 2500 |
| Unfreezing transplantation (FET) | 4,200 | Including endometrial monitoring and anesthesia on the day of transplantation |
| Drug cost (FET cycle) | 600-1,000 | Oral+Vaginal+Progesterone Oil |
| Pregnancy monitoring (up to 10 weeks) | 1,800 | 3 ultrasounds+2 blood tests |
| contingency budget | 2,000 | Sudden changes such as hysteroscopy, appendicitis, ovarian torsion, etc |
| total | 28,000-32,000 | Excluding airfare and accommodation |

7、 Law and Ethics: There is no federal "embryo disposal law" in the United States, and there are significant differences among states
California allows both spouses to agree in writing on the ownership of embryos. In the event of divorce, the embryos will be executed according to the contract, and there is no mandatory requirement for "transplantation or destruction". Therefore, international patients most commonly send surplus embryos to California. In Texas, it is stipulated that "embryos must be given to the party who claims to have children when divorcing," and if neither party claims, they are allowed to be destroyed. When signing the Embryo Storage Agreement, it is essential to confirm three points: 1 If the renewal is not made after 5 years, does the clinic have the right to unilaterally dispose of it; 2. If one spouse dies, does the embryo become the property of the surviving spouse; 3. Is it allowed to transfer to other states or countries. 8、 Insurance and refunds: not 'package success', but' risk pool '
No insurance company in the United States is willing to provide an "unlimited transplant" plan for women over 38 years old, but some clinics have partnered with third party financial companies to launch a "multi cycle bundle" plan: prepay for 3 transplant fees, and if none of the 3 transplant fees result in clinical pregnancy, 70% will be refunded. Please note that the definition of "clinical pregnancy" in the terms is "fetal heart rate positive", not blood hCG positive, therefore empty sacs or biochemistry are not within the scope of refund. 9、 Returning to China for prenatal check ups: How to connect "American embryos" with "Chinese obstetrics"
1. At 6 weeks of pregnancy: Bring the "Embryo Transfer Certificate+β - hCG Doubling Form" issued by a US hospital to the domestic community health service center for filing. The staff will manually enter the "due date" field, and the system will not verify the fertilization location. 2. 12 weeks of pregnancy: Obstetrics departments of tertiary hospitals require the addition of an "early pregnancy ultrasound report". If the report is in English, it needs to be stamped by a translation company. The translation template can be downloaded from the INCINTA Chinese official website. 3. At 16 weeks of pregnancy: When performing non-invasive DNA testing, the laboratory will ask "Is assisted reproduction possible?" Answer truthfully without affecting the risk assessment. 4. 24 weeks of pregnancy: Stop progesterone 3 days before the glucose tolerance test to avoid progesterone induced insulin resistance and false positives.
